Position Overview:
As a Shipyard Refrigeration Technician , you will be responsible for inspecting, maintaining, troubleshooting, installing, and repairing air conditioning and refrigeration (AC/R) equipment, components, and systems. This position involves working on Navy vessels and various job sites, ensuring optimal system performance and adherence to safety and regulatory standards. You will work closely with the Project Manager and team to ensure work progress and quality.
Key Responsibilities:
Maintenance & Repairs:
Inspect, test, repair, and replace faulty AC/R systems, components, and circuits on Navy vessels and other job sites.
System Adjustments:
Adjust system controls and settings based on manufacturer recommendations to ensure system balance.
Customer Liaison:
Communicate with customers to assess issues, schedule work, and track project progress.
Knowledge Application:
Utilize basic AC/R theory, Navy specifications, material properties, and operation principles to troubleshoot and maintain systems.
System Assembly & Mounting:
Assemble, position, and mount AC/R equipment based on blueprints and manufacturer specifications, ensuring compliance with standards and codes.
Troubleshooting & Testing:
Perform troubleshooting and testing of 24-volt DC, 110-volt AC, and 440-volt AC systems.
Refrigerant Handling:
Practice safe, regulatory handling of various refrigerants used in AC/R equipment.
Tools & Equipment Use:
Operate various tools, such as refrigeration gages, recovery machines, vacuum pumps, power tools, and test equipment (volt-ohm meters, ammeters, etc.).
Physical Demands:
Perform physically demanding tasks like lifting heavy objects, positioning HVACR equipment, and working at heights.
Project Support:
Assist the Project Manager, supervisor, and foreman in completing necessary tasks and duties.
Qualifications & Experience:
High school diploma or GED required. 4+ years of related experience or equivalent combination of training and experience in the maritime field. Tech school/Trade school certification preferred but not required. EPA Universal Certification required. Basic knowledge of AC/R systems, theory, Navy specifications, and properties of materials. Ability to work with electrical systems ranging from 24-volt DC to 440-volt AC. Experience using various AC/R tools and testing equipment. Ability to lift heavy objects and work in physically demanding environments.
Work Environment:
This position will require working on Navy vessels, job sites, and in workshops. The work environment can include confined spaces, heights, and other challenging conditions.
